Could there really be love like in novels?

Could there really be love like in novels?

2024-09-21 18:56
1 answer

Love in novels referred to romantic, mysterious, dramatic, and transcendental emotional experiences. It usually involved the emotional communication and interaction between two people, as well as their recognition and agreement with each other's beliefs, values, and lifestyle. In real life, there were indeed some touching and intoxicating love stories. These stories depicted the complexity and variety of human emotions, and showed the courage and tenacity of human beings in terms of emotions and morality. However, these stories were not universal, and it did not mean that everyone would experience such love. Love is a very personal experience. Everyone's emotions and experiences are unique. Some people may experience romantic and profound love while others may experience plain and ordinary love. In addition, love is also affected by many factors such as personal background, social culture, life experience, etc. Although the love stories in novels are very attractive, we can't guarantee that they will happen to us. However, reading novels can help us understand the complexity of human emotions and how to express and explore our emotions in our own lives.

Is there really no unforgettable love like in novels?

Of course, the love in novels was very colorful, and some of them were unforgettable. However, everyone's experience and feelings were different. Not all love could be as intoxicating and profound as in novels. Love in novels was often a romantic imagination that was different from reality. In real life, people's love may face various challenges and difficulties such as distance, family, money, career, etc. These factors may weaken the power of love and make it less unforgettable. Even if there was a deep relationship between two people, it might not be able to overcome all difficulties. In real life, people might quarrel or even break up over small matters. These setbacks and contradictions might make love less profound. Although the love in novels is very profound, they are just fictional stories and should not be regarded as a guide to reality. Everyone's love story was unique. One should cherish and experience their own love instead of trying to copy the plot in the novel.

Could humans really cultivate like in novels?

Cultivation was a broad concept that usually referred to the improvement of human physical and mental abilities through cultivation and other methods to reach a realm beyond the ordinary human level. However, the authenticity of cultivation novels was controversial because cultivation novels were often fictional stories without scientific basis. Although the authenticity of cultivation novels was controversial, some of the cultivation methods in the novels could be traced in real life. For example, Chinese Qigong, Taoist cultivation, Christian spiritual cultivation, and other methods all attempted to improve physical and mental abilities by adjusting the physical and mental state. However, not everyone could successfully practice these methods. The success of cultivation required a long period of persistence and hard work, as well as sufficient patience and perseverance, as well as the correct method and guidance. At the same time, the process of cultivation also involved many dangers and challenges. One needed to have a certain physical and psychological quality. Therefore, cultivation novels were just fictional stories and could not represent real life experiences. However, through reading cultivation novels, we can understand the process of improving human physical and mental abilities, as well as the different cultivation methods and cultural backgrounds.
